Ravens receiver coach David Culley beats out Leslie Frazier and Eric Bieniemy for the Texans head coaching job. His status as a friend of quarterback Deshaun Watson likely helped. Watson met Culley at the Pro Bowl a few years back and the two reportedly hit it off.

Culley also received an endorsement from Andy Reid after having worked under Reid at previous coaching stops. So the team ends up with an Andy Reid guy, just not the one people expected.

Additionally, it's reported that Watson favorite Tim Kelly will retain his job as offensive coordinator. Others said to be joining the coaching staff include Lovie Smith and possibly Josh McCown.

Despite being 65 years old, and as such the oldest first time head coach ever hired, Culley has a reputation for relating well with younger players.

Will be interesting to see wherr the Deshaun Watson saga goes from here.
